The Ultimate Aerosmith Experience - Part 2
How do you get 16,000 people to stand, dance, wave their arms, sing and have the absolute best time of their
life? Experience AEROSMITH. And what an experience it was in Greenville, S.C. on Saturday night. With the
show starting at 9:00 p.m. and finishing up at 11:00 p.m., it was two hours packed with solid, hard rockin' - kick
ass music. What can I say, "One Way Street" and "Livin' On The Edge" for the encore!! WOW!
I am constantly amazed with the energy The Boys have. With ramps set up on the sides and behind the stage,
they really put them to use! No one in the audience was left out. Each one of The Boys made a point to play to
the whole audience (including those with seats behind the stage) and the effort they put into to that was well
appreciated by the fans.

Back In The Saddle
Same Old Song And Dance
Love In A Elevator
Falling In Love
Ragdoll
Dream On
Janie's Got A Gun
Eat The Rich
Last Child
Pink
Draw The Line
Stop Messin' Round
Mother Popcorn/drum solo/ Walk This Way
I Don't Want To Miss A Thing
Cryin'
Dude (Looks Like A Lady)
Encore
One Way Street
Livin' On The Edge
Sweet Emotions/Heartbreaker
Mr. Tyler presented himself to us is in a pair of orange, white, and black psychedelic pants with a black shirt,
black vest and a long orange coat topped off with a black hat tied with a purple scarf. (yes, the Chiquita sticker
was there!) Interesting note: Steven was donning a new tattoo on his upper right arm! It was one that gave
the appearance of a band around his bicep. Getting a closer look with the faithful binoculars, it looked as if it
was one of the temporary nature. Anyone going to future shows, report back if it is still there! Maybe he did
add another one!
Joe Cool (and believe me, he looked cool!) came out in a black pin striped suit (vest too!) with the pinstripes
being sequins. Adding some color with a red silk shirt (like the one he wore at the Oscars) and that great
Leopard print coat. Oh, and of course! His Shades! Tom had on a black suit with white pinstripes and looked
mighty fine! Brad was looking quite dapper in black pants, gray silk shirt and a purple jacket. Joey played it up
with a multi-colored long sleeved shirt, royal blue vest and (you guessed it!) black spandex pants.
For the encore, Steven had on a white button down shirt (unbuttoned and tied at the waist, of course!). Joe
added a twist to his outfit by wearing the red shirt around his waist and allowing his vest to serve as his "shirt".
This is a good example of how things vary from venue to venue. Printed plainly on each ticket were the words
we hate, "NO CAMERAS". But there were cameras galore throughout the arena and no one (that I saw) had
their film/camera confiscated. There was one person from security (again, that I could see) in our area.
Nothing was said until someone stood in their seat, stood in the aisle, etc. I did see a lot of flashes!
